YouSendIt provides a trusted, convenient and smart solution for transferring large files over the Internet, replacing the need for FTP transfers or overnight courier. YouSendIt makes it really easy to deliver files larger than what your email service may allow.

YouSendIt has different service plans. Most of them have a monthly fee. These plans allow you to send files up to 2GB, but the service Lite is completely free.
YouSendIt can now count more than 10 million people among its registered users, which is a big step for a small business that started in 2004. Part of the reason YouSendIt’s had its best two quarters in the company’s history this year is that enterprises are catching on, and the company’s Corporate Suite now has 1,500 registered companies after only two years in the market.
Some of the larger companies using YouSendIt’s solutions are Shell Oil, Sprint and ABC.
Beyond being a really simple information transfer service and alleviating email restrictions, YouSendIt in many cases is replacing FTP systems as a simpler, more secure way to transfer data.
The free service allows you to:
* Send files up to 100MB with a 1GB of monthly download limit
* Allow up to 100 download of every file
* Keep track of your friend’s and family’s email addresses in one handy location
* Give your recipients 7 days to download the files you’ve sent
How does it work?

Step1
Enter the recipient email address and an optional message
Step2
Attach your file and click “Send it”
Step3
Your recipients receive an email that lets them inmediately click and download the file

YouSendIt Soars Past 10 Million Users
Rapid growth propels YouSendIt to world’s most popular secure digital file delivery service
CAMPBELL, Calif. – August 20, 2009 – YouSendIt, Inc. announced its latest milestone today, now counting more than 10 million people among its registered user base, accelerating at the rate of a quarter million new users each month. Since its founding in 2004, YouSendIt has established itself as the most widely used secure digital file delivery service on the Web, capitalizing on increased corporate demand for fast, secure and compliant information transfer.
Experiencing its two best quarters in the history of the company this year, YouSendIt now has more than 100,000 paid subscribers and completes more than 10,000 new pay-per-use transactions per month. In addition, YouSendIt’s corporate solution has attracted more than 1,500 companies after a mere two years in the market.
YouSendIt has seen significant traction among small and midsized businesses and within specific line-of-business functions where the need for secure, fast delivery of large volumes of digital data is paramount. YouSendIt is also finding success among large enterprises, counting organizations such as ABC, BP, Chevron, Conde Nast, Disney, GE, MTV, Shell Oil, Sprint, Starbucks and the US Army among its customers.
“Five years ago, we set out with one goal: to delight our customers and exceed their expectations. Now, 10 million registered users later, YouSendIt has validated secure digital file delivery as a viable professional and business solution for critical, secure information transfer,” said Ranjith Kumaran, CTO and co-founder of YouSendIt. “Moving forward, our focus will continue to be on easing the pains of business document delivery and collaboration, while increasing value to our IT customers with cost reduction, enhanced security and compliance enforcement, all of which will help us continue growing our leading market share.”
YouSendIt’s 10 millionth user was Barry Smith, MD, PhD, director of The Rogosin Institute in New York City, a not-for-profit institution for research, treatment, and education relating to kidney disease, diabetes, hypertension, cancer and lipid (cholesterol) control. Employing more than 350 doctors, nurses, researchers and administrative employees, the Institute’s mission is fostering understanding of disease and bringing the resulting research advances to patients and clinics as quickly as possible. Rogosin is an affiliate of The New York Presbyterian Hospital Weill Cornell Medical College and is a member of the New York- Presbyterian Healthcare System.
The Institute needed to send large files—such as data from clinical trials of potential new therapies, research data and manuscripts, protocols, and digital imaging files—to collaborators both within and outside the Institute, as well as government agencies and institutional review panels. All of this data had to be sent back and forth quickly, reliably, and— most important—securely.
“YouSendIt lets us deliver critical laboratory, clinical research and care information, and work products quickly and safely throughout our Institute, as well as to a variety of outside partners,” said Dr. Smith. “We no longer need to worry about the capacity of the recipients’ e-mail servers or networks. File transfer has become a smooth and simple process.”
In addition to its growing customer base, YouSendIt has also expanded its service capabilities and debuted its first mobile application for the iPhone this year. In July, it also unveiled a new Microsoft Outlook plug-in, allowing users to send entire folders via the digital file delivery service. The company also received industry recognition for its market leadership. It was awarded a Stevie Award for “Best Overall Company,” voted a Webware 100 winner, and named a Network Products Guide Hot Company and a Red Herring North America 100 winner.
